An 82-year-old diabetic client is being treated in the hospital for a sacral pressure ulcer. What age-related change is most likely to affect the client's course of treatment?
Increased thickness of the subcutaneous skin layer
Changes in the character and quantity of bacterial skin flora
Increased time required for wound healing
Increased elasticity of the skin
The Correct Answer is C
A. Increased thickness of the subcutaneous skin layer - Aging typically results in thinning of the skin and subcutaneous tissue, making older adults more vulnerable to pressure ulcers rather than having increased thickness.
B. Changes in the character and quantity of bacterial skin flora - This is a common age-related change; however, it is not directly related to the course of treatment for a sacral pressure ulcer. Proper wound care can mitigate the impact of changes in skin flora.
C. Increased time required for wound healing - Aging often leads to a decline in the body's ability to repair and regenerate tissues, which can prolong the healing process of wounds, including pressure ulcers. Older adults may experience delayed wound healing compared to younger individuals.
D. Increased elasticity of the skin - Skin elasticity decreases with age, making older adults more susceptible to skin breakdown and pressure ulcers due to reduced skin resilience and ability to redistribute pressure. Increased elasticity would not affect the course of treatment positively but rather negatively in this context.

To calculate the number of hours required to infuse two 1L bags of normal saline at a rate of 80 ml/hr, you can use the following formula:
Time (hours) = Total volume (ml) / Infusion rate (ml/hr)
First, calculate the total volume of normal saline to be infused:
Total volume = 2 bags x 1L/bag x 1000 ml/L = 2000 ml
Now, plug this into the formula:
Time (hours) = 2000 ml / 80 ml/hr
Time (hours) = 25 hours
So, it will take 25 hours to infuse the total amount of normal saline at a rate of 80 ml/hr, assuming no interruptions in the infusion. Rounded to the nearest whole number, it will take 25 hours.
